Cleanroom Compounding Pharmacies: Maintaining Medication Quality

Compounding pharmacies specializing in sterile preparations represent a essential element of the healthcare field. These facilities, often referred to as sterile environments, employ strict protocols and state-of-the-art equipment to create medications that meet the ultimate standards of sterility. The process involves meticulous air filtration, ongoing surface sanitation, and specific personnel training to reduce the risk of impurities .

  • Meticulous attention is given to every step of the formulation process.
  • Strict adherence to United States Pharmacopeia (USP) <797> guidelines is essential .
  • Frequent verification and documentation are necessary to confirm the drug’s integrity.
This dedication to precision is key for individual safety and treatment results.

Operating Rooms and Cleanroom Standards: Best Practices

Ensuring the level of purity in surgical suites and sterile processing areas is absolutely crucial for minimizing surgical site infections. Recommended guidelines require strict adherence to defined protocols, like complete sterilization of equipment, sufficient air exchange processes, and regular assessment of environmental conditions. Healthcare professionals must obtain targeted training on sterile techniques and adhere stringent hand hygiene procedures. In addition, regular inspections and validation methods are vital to ensure ongoing adherence and patient well-being.
